Steel Hawk plans to raise RM3.2mil from LEAP Market listing


KUALA LUMPUR: Oil and gas support services provider Steel Hawk Bhd aims to raise RM3.2mil from a listing on the LEAP Market of Bursa Malaysia to fund its expansion plans.

In a statement issued in conjunction with the launch of its information memorandum, the group said the listing exercise involves the placement of 16 million shares or 10% of its enlarged issued share capital to selected sophisticated investors at 20 sen per share.

The proceeds of the listing will go towards its growth strategy, among which includes the setting up of two fire-rated door assembly line and the construction of a mud cooler system.

Apart from the share placement, the remaining 144 million shares in the compay are held by the promoters.

Post-listing, the company will implement a dividend policy to return a minimum of 30% of its earnings to shareholders.

Steel Hawk, via its subsidiary Steel Hawk Engineering Sdn Bhd, began in October 2012 as a provider of engineering, procurement, construction and commissioning services for chemical injection skids at offshore exploration and production platforms.

Following an expansion, the group is now primarily involved in oil and gas support services, which include EPCC services, facilities improvement and maintenance and the maintenance and supply of oilfield equipment.

According to Steel Hawk’s group executive director and CEO Datuk Sharman Kristy Michael, the group aims to expand its footprint in overseas markets, primarily Brunei and Indonesia.

Over the medium term, it plans to appoint distributors and suppliers in these countries and leverage their networks to supply products to the oil and gas industry.
